Dysfunctional Magnetism
Sanguine Entertainment is proud to present it's latest series - Dysfunctional Magnetism. The show is real life stories of Jacob O'Neal. Don't worry, he's mostly left out the Brian Wilson type years of lying in bed and getting fat while doing nothing at all. No, this show will be about a man on the cusp of turning 40 and reflecting on his to determine what made into the "Lonely, single loser he is". Those were his words and in no way reflect the feelings or opinions of Sanguine Entertainment.
You can here the first episode, How Did I Get Here?, right now on Soundcloud. In the introductory episode Jacob describes himself as a perpetual motion machine powered by arrested development. Punches will not be pulled, names have been changed to protect theinnocent guilty from suing Jacob. All events are mostly true with very little exaggeration for dramatic or humorous effect. Enjoy.

The Gorram Nerd Hour Returns
Hello Everyone,
It's been a while. But we never forgot about you. Hopefully you didn'tthink forget about us. It's a long story as to why The Gorram Nerd Hour took such a long hiatus, starting with Brian and myself not wanting to continue on together. Rest assured, this doesn't mean that we're no longer friends. We are. We just decided that it was time to move on separately. So when I saw WE'RE back I suppose I actually mean me, Jacob O'Neal. I wanted to find a good fit for a co-host and I believe that my long search finally came to an end when I decided on Jeremy Taylor.
A quick background on Jeremy - He's a nerd, first and foremost. He's funny and can get angry. And strangely he also has affinity for the F word just like Brian. So, although the show may feel a little different, we promise that we will still be delivering the same irreverent humor and nerdy news as always.
What we can promise you moving forward is some of the same as what we gave you before and a whole lottalovin' new bits and features. Jeremy and I are in the planning stages right now to bring you a lot of what you loved about the show before but give it a whole new life filled with weirdness and humor.
Stay tuned. The first episode with myself and Jeremy will be available this week!

Coming Soon!
My name is Jacob O'Neal. I am veteran podcaster, having clocked in several hours co-hosting such shows as The Gorram Nerd Hour, From The Underground, The Science Of Fiction and Holodeck Malfunction. After the time I spent working on those shows I have decided to start a network for podcasts of all different types - starting with our flagship series Voice For Veterans hosted by Royal W Sander.
Royal is a veteran of the Vietnam war, a skilled pilot and a true patriot. We are very excited to have him making his podcast debut soon. On the show he will be talking to other vets about topics that concern them - dealing with PTSD, the treatment of soldiers by the VA and many other topics. Royal will be visited by different guests nearly every week.
Beyond that I will be launching my own show, much in the vein of The Gorram Nerd Hour, filled with humor, nerd topics, interviews and much more with my co-host Neil Gallivan. We have been in talks to add several other shows about current events, politics, music and more.
We hope to see you back here in February as we launch Voice For Veterans.
